Course details

Crisis Communication Fundamentals: Understanding the principles and theories of crisis communication, crisis response strategies, and the role of communication in crisis management.
Risk Perception and Communication: Exploring how individuals and organizations perceive and communicate about risks, including risk assessment, risk communication ethics, and public engagement.
Media Relations in Crisis: Examining the role of media in crisis communication, media relations strategies, and working with journalists during a crisis.
Social Media and Crisis Communication: Understanding the impact of social media on crisis communication, social media monitoring, and using social media for crisis communication and management.
Crisis Leadership and Decision Making: Exploring the role of leadership in crisis management, decision-making processes, and ethical considerations in crisis management.
Crisis Preparedness and Planning: Developing crisis communication plans, including crisis simulations, training and exercising, and building crisis communication teams.
Crisis Communication Case Studies: Analyzing real-world crisis communication cases, identifying best practices and lessons learned, and applying them to future crisis scenarios.
